1/JA/1929 Buenos Aires - Asunción del Paraguay - Buenos Aires - Montevideo: 2 Covers carried on experimental flight of Aeroposta Argentina S.A., subsidiary of Compañía General Aeropostal (round flights, the return flight to Uruguay). The first cover, outbound leg, bears a dispatching cancel of Buenos Aires 31/DE/1928 (day before the flight, which took off on 1/JA at 6 am, there were 2 LATE-25 monoplanes which carried less than 5 covers) and Asunción arrival with date error (it says February), sent by Count Dedalot. The return flight has a dispatching cancel of Asunción 1/JA/1929 (the planes took off on 2/JA at 6 am and carried less than 10 covers, and this piece is the ONLY ONE with final destination Uruguay!), with Buenos Aires arrival of 2/JA and Montevideo arrival of 3/JA (on back at bottom right) and another one of 16/MAR when it was probably delivered, and SIGNED BY PILOT FICARELLI. Excellent lot, UNIQUE, fantastic document from the times of the early development of Argentine aviation with small planes and daring pilots! Ex-Algerio Nonis
